The University of California at Riverside is
trying to hire some visiting assistant professors.
We plan to make decisions quite soon.
The positions are open to applicants with a
minimum of Ph.D or will have a Ph.D by the
beginning of the term from all research areas
in Mathematics. The teaching load is six courses
per year (i.e. 2 per quarter). In addition to
teaching, the applicants will be responsible for
attending advanced seminars and working on
research projects.
This is initially a one-year appointment, and with
successful annual teaching review, it is renewable
for up to a third year term.
